Operating the tumble dryer
f Optical interface
This is used by the Service depart-
ment as a transmission point.
g Sensors for extra options
You can select extra options to aug-
ment drying programmes.
If a drying programme has been se-
lected, the sensor controls for the
possible extra options light up dimly.
h  sensor
You can use the  sensor to call up
an energy consumption forecast for
the selected drying programme.
See "Washing environmentally and
economically", section
"EcoFeedback" for more informa-
tion.
i  sensors
The  sensor starts the delay start
function. With the delay start func-
tion, you can choose when you want
the programme to start. The start of
the programme can be delayed from
15 minutes up to a maximum of 24
hours. This allows you to make use
of night-time economy electricity
rates, for example.
For further information see "4. Se-
lecting programme settings"

j Start/Add laundry sensor control
Touching the Start/Add laun-
dry sensor control starts a pro-
gramme. The current programme
can be interrupted to add laundry.
The programme can be started when
the sensor control is flashing on and
off. The sensor control lights up con-
stantly once the programme has
started.
k Programme selector
This is used for selecting pro-
grammes and for switching off. The
tumble dryer is switched on by se-
lecting a programme and switched
off by turning the programme se-
lector to the  position.
Under Further programmes/ you
will find:
– The Wash2Dry function as well as
additional programmes
– The option to change Settings
